Abstract
The utility model discloses a kind of fillet device of copper rod end, including engine base, the left side of engine base is equipped with the traversing slide block structure for being used for clamping copper rod, the right side of engine base is equipped with fillet stent, the fillet rolling bearing laterally set is installed in the middle part of fillet stent, the inside of fillet rolling bearing is provided with fillet module installation axle, and the front end of fillet module installation axle is provided with has fillet groove for the fillet module to copper rod end fillet, the inside of fillet module;The rearward end of fillet module installation axle is equipped with driving structure, and the end of copper rod is pushed into completion fillet operation in fillet groove by traversing slide block structure.The fillet module of the utility model, which is installed on, to be driven by motor in the fillet module installation axle turned, this makes it possible to eliminate fillet operation to use rotation manually, in addition the traversing slide block structure of a hand propelled is also used, copper rod is pushed into the fillet groove of fillet module using traversing slide block structure, the labor intensity of operator is thus greatly reduced, and ensure that the standard and quality of fillet.

Technical field
The processing technique field of copper products is the utility model is related to, refers specifically to a kind of fillet device of copper rod end.
Background technology
In the processing of copper material, the copper rod produced generally requires to carry out fillet processing, and traditional copper rod end exists
All it is artificially to use fillet mould during fillet, hand rotation fillet mould carries out fillet operation, such processing side to copper rod
Method is in processing, due to will be while hold copper rod, rotation fillet mould on one side so that the working strength of master workers compares
Greatly, and hand-held processing fillet speed it is slower, the quality of fillet can not ensure.

Embodiment
Utility model is described in detail with reference to the accompanying drawings and examples.
As shown in Figure 1,2 and 3, the utility model proposes a kind of copper rod end fillet device, it is characterised in that:Including
Engine base 1, the left side of engine base 1 are equipped with the traversing slide block structure for being used for clamping copper rod 2, and the right side of engine base is equipped with a fillet stent 3, circle
The fillet rolling bearing 4 laterally set is installed, the inside of fillet rolling bearing 4 is provided with fillet module peace in the middle part of angle support
Axis 5 is filled, fillet module installation axle 5 is in hollow tubular, and the front end of fillet module installation axle 5 is provided with for justifying to copper rod end
The fillet module 6 at angle, the inside of fillet module have fillet groove 61;The rearward end of fillet module installation axle 5, which is equipped with, to be used to drive
The end of copper rod 2 is pushed into by the driving structure that fillet module installation axle 5 rotates on fillet rolling bearing 4, traversing slide block structure
Fillet operation is completed in fillet groove 61.
Traversing slide block structure include be arranged on engine base on traversing sliding block 7, be arranged on inside traversing sliding block 7 along traversing sliding block 7
Extended T-shaped sliding slot 8, the hand push slide 81 inside T-shaped sliding slot, the perpendicular push plate 9 being fixed on hand push slide, with
And the guide sleeve 10 on engine base 1 is fixed on, there is one front fillet groove is inserted into and imported into for copper rod 2 for the inside of guide sleeve 10
Guiding duct 11 in 61, perpendicular push plate 9 leans to one side to be equipped with the convenient limiting groove for promoting copper rod forward, before being oriented to duct 11
End has facilitate copper rod 2 to be inserted into extend out formula hole section.A hand push lever 12 is additionally provided with the leaning to one side of perpendicular push plate 9.
Fillet module 6 includes die holder 13 and the fillet mould 14 in die holder 13, and the inside of die holder 13, which has to house, justifies
The mold slots of angle mould 14, fillet mould 14 are fixed by the fastening screw penetrated from die holder 13, and fillet groove 61 is arranged on fillet mould 14
Inside.The periphery of die holder 13 is equipped with annular mounting portion 15, and annular mounting portion 15 is caught in the front end annular groove of fillet module installation axle
It is interior, and the annular mounting portion 15 is fixed in fillet module installation axle by lock screw 16.Fillet mould 14 is using ceramic frosted
Block is made.
Driving structure include be installed on fillet module installation axle axle body outside driven gear 17, on fillet stent
Driving motor 18 and the driving gear 19 on driving 18 output shaft of motor, driven gear 17 mutually nibbles with driving gear
Close.A water-cooling-sprayer 20 for facing 6 Seeding location of fillet module downward is additionally provided with fillet stent 3.
When specifically used, start driving motor work, rotate driving gear, drive driven gear to rotate, so that circle
Corner Block List Representation installation axle rotates in fillet rolling bearing, and fillet module is installed on the inside of fillet module installation axle, fillet module
It is fixed on by the annular mounting portion of periphery in the mesoporous of fillet module installation axle, such fillet module installation axle rotates, fillet
Module also rotates together.So the fillet groove of fillet module also and then rotates together.
In fillet, master worker promotes forward hand push slide or perpendicular push plate, and hand push slide is in I-shaped, and hand push slide exists
The forward slip of T-shaped sliding slot, one end of copper rod are directly placed in limiting groove, and the copper rod other end passes through guide sleeve 10, are utilized
The pass of guide sleeve can be accurately imported into fillet groove.With the rotation of fillet module, and then the end of copper rod can be allowed
Complete fillet.In fillet, water-cooling-sprayer is constantly washed by water to following fillet position.
